As our SAP Analyst you will support and optimize warehouse operations through SAP ERP, SAP EWM, and the CCAWS Automated Storage and Retrieval System (ASRS). Additionally you will serve as the primary liaison between Distribution Operations, Information Technology, Automation Controls, and third-party vendors to ensure seamless system performance and inventory accuracy.

Key Responsibilities and Job Duties

  • Support SAP ERP warehouse transactions and inventory processes.
  • Monitor and troubleshoot SAP EWM inbound, outbound, replenishment, and RF activities.
  • Support CCAWS ASRS operations, mission management, inventory synchronization, and system integration.
  • Monitor interfaces, IDocs, queues, middleware, and transaction failures.
  • Perform root cause analysis and lead issue resolution efforts.
  • Support testing, upgrades, user training, and process improvements.

Education and Qualifications

  • 3+ years supporting SAP ERP and/or SAP EWM.
  • Experience in distribution, warehouse, or manufacturing operations.
  • Strong analytical and troubleshooting skills.
  • Experience working with cross-functional teams and vendors.

Preferred Technical and Functional Skills

  • 2 years SAP ERP, SAP S/4HANA, SAP EWM, RF Framework experience.
  • Experience supporting ASRS or warehouse automation environments.
  • Knowledge of CCAWS
  • Familiarity with IDocs
  • SAP EWM certification preferred.

Corinth Coca-Cola currently operates in Corinth, Miss.; Tupelo, Miss; Lexington, Tenn.; and Jackson, Tenn. Upon the completion of its territory expansion, Corinth Coca-Cola will operate in five states and increase its headcount by almost 30% to approximately 450 associates. Corinth Coca-Cola Bottling Works, Inc. is a privately held, family-owned Coca-Cola bottling and distribution company. Founded by Avon Kenneth Weaver and C.C. Clark in 1907 in Corinth, Miss., Weaver descendants continue to own and operate the company today. In addition to its headquarters in Corinth, Corinth Coca-Cola Bottling Works currently has locations in Lexington, Tenn.; Jackson, Tenn.; and Tupelo, Miss.
